Water damage can strike unexpectedly and depart homeowners feeling overwhelmed. Understanding DIY water damage restoration techniques for homeowners can empower people to tackle these challenges successfully. The first step in any restoration process includes assessing the extent of the damage. This allows householders to gauge whether DIY techniques will be sufficient or if skilled assist is required.


Once the initial assessment is full, it is crucial to cease further water intrusion. This might involve shutting off the primary water supply if a pipe is burst or utilizing a moist vacuum to eliminate standing water. Swift motion can significantly minimize damage, preventing mold and structural issues from setting in. Proper security gear should be worn during this process, including gloves and boots, to ensure protected handling of doubtless contaminated water.


After securing the realm, owners should collect the required tools and supplies. Essential objects embody a wet/dry vacuum, dehumidifiers, followers, mop, buckets, towels, and cleansing options specifically designed for water damage. Equip your self with these instruments to facilitate an environment friendly restoration process. Ensure the world is well-ventilated, which helps in drying out wet spaces and minimizing potential odor and mold progress (Hail Damage Restoration Georgetown Ky).

Cleaning and drying are integral steps in any water damage restoration. Start by removing wet objects from the affected area. This could embody furniture, rugs, and any belongings that can take in moisture. Many of these items could be cleaned and salvaged, so take the time to gauge their condition. Once removed, it’s time to address partitions, flooring, and ceilings, ensuring that all remaining moisture is extracted.


Using a wet/dry vacuum to extract water from carpets and upholstery can be incredibly efficient. For hardwood flooring, immediate action is important. Quick drying can prevent warping, and elevating carpets can allow air to flow into beneath. Ensure proper towels are used to blot up water spots and keep away from rubbing, as this could additional damage the fibers.


Mold is a big concern in water damage scenarios. Even at decrease humidity levels, mold can begin to develop within 24 to forty eight hours of water publicity. To thwart this, utilize followers and dehumidifiers around the house to take care of air circulation. Keeping humidity levels under 60% is good for mold prevention. Regularly monitor these ranges during the drying process utilizing a hygrometer for an effective evaluation.


In tackling drywall that has succumbed to water damage, cutting out affected sections may be needed. This may involve eradicating portions of the drywall to reveal the studs and allow thorough drying. Replace any moldy sections promptly and seal the realm as soon as dried. Homeowners should contemplate making use of a mold-inhibiting primer to the new drywall to further shield in opposition to future points.

Sanitization is one other critical factor of this DIY approach. After drying, cleaning the surfaces with water and detergent is essential to get rid of any residual contaminants. For more durable stains or odors, utilizing an answer of vinegar and water could be a natural different. Ensure that all areas are totally rinsed and dried afterward to forestall moisture retention.


As you progress towards restoring the aesthetic qualities of your house, choose appropriate painting or ending products that provide water resistant qualities. When repainting, consider using mold-resistant paints, which can add an additional layer of safety towards potential future water incidents. helpful resources Additionally, recheck areas that were not immediately affected, as moisture can linger and cause unseen damage.

Preventing future water damage is paramount to ensuring a safe and cozy setting. Homeowners should routinely inspect plumbing fixtures and home equipment, looking for leaks or signs of wear and tear. Maintaining gutters and downspouts additionally helps direct water away from the muse, minimizing risks throughout heavy rain or snowmelt. Investing in common maintenance can save significant effort and time down the line.


Educating family members about water damage procedures can foster a collective response during a crisis. Create a response plan detailing who does what, ensuring that everybody knows their roles during an incident. This preparedness can drastically cut back stress when a sudden leak or flood happens, allowing for a swift, organized method to restoring the house.

Immediately turn off the main power supply to prevent electrical hazards, and shut off the water valve to cease further damage. Next, assess the extent of the damage and doc it with photos for insurance coverage functions.


How can I effectively dry out my house after water damage?


Use fans, dehumidifiers, and natural ventilation to advertise evaporation. Open doors and this hyperlink windows to extend airflow, and consider using absorbent supplies like towels or mops to take in excess water.
